If your issue is climate change or fracking you know that the fossil fuel industry and billionaires like the Koch bros are risking our future. And 90% of that mountain of money goes to the GOP.
Wall Street and TBTF banks? Talk about money influencing politics, even the Democratic party big time.
Gun control? The firearms industry money directly and through the NRA and other gun groups.
The military budget, war and mass surveillance? The military/intelligence/industrial complex money fuels DC.
If you are a Single Payer activist, it's the greedy insurance and big pharma $billions. I know, we are going to get around this in the final showdown but it is not easy.
LGBT rights and women's choice? You must be aware of the Catholic and religious right money getting its way.
Money, money, money. The vast majority going to the Tea Party/GOP or increasingly corrupting the Democratic party. Even at the state level as in California.
On the other side, if you are an activist like me, you get many emails every day asking for money from all sorts of Dem politicians at all levels using the huge donations to the other side as a rationale. And many many emails asking for donations to help overturn Citizens United.

Since Citizens United and lately McCutcheon, the right wing Supreme Court has essentially turned us into a plutocracy.
The good news is that there IS a movement to introduce a constitutional amendment to overturn the catastrophe of Citizens United, McCutcheon and Buckley.
This week, the movement goes to Sacramento with the March for Democracy.
